A thick, buttery crust pizza baked in a deep pan with layers of cheese, toppings, and chunky tomato sauce. It is one of Chicago’s most iconic and debated local specialties.
An all-beef hot dog on a poppy seed bun topped with yellow mustard, relish, onions, tomato, pickle spear, sport peppers, and celery salt. It is a classic local street food served without ketchup.
Thinly sliced seasoned roast beef piled onto an Italian roll, often dipped in its juices and topped with sweet peppers or giardiniera. It is a defining working-class Chicago sandwich.

Chicago is pricey for hotels and dining, but budget eats and public transit help keep daily costs manageable.
Tip 18-20% at restaurants; 15-20% for taxis and rideshares; USD 1-2 per drink at bars; USD 1-2 per bag for bellhops; USD 2-5 per night for housekeeping.
